Better Verified: Mcp2515 Proteus Library

A great MCP2515 library should be reliable, well-supported, and compatible with your microcontroller. Here are the best options available for Proteus and your microcontroller.

You can test 125kbps, 250kbps, 500kbps, or 1Mbps without communication errors.

Load your firmware (e.g., using the popular mcp_can Arduino library) into the microcontrollers. Hit the play button in Proteus.

: You can find custom CAN-Bus Shields designed for Proteus which allow you to simulate the entire shield rather than just the chip. 2. Best Arduino Firmware Libraries (Performance Comparison) mcp2515 proteus library better

Open Proteus, open the schematic capture tool, and press P to pick devices. Search for "MCP2515" to see your newly updated component. Step-by-Step Simulation Setup for CAN Bus

However, many users encounter issues with the default or basic libraries available for the MCP2515 in Proteus. These issues often involve poor simulation performance, incomplete pinouts, or lack of proper protocol timing.

Upgrading to a better MCP2515 Proteus library removes the guesswork from CAN bus embedded development. By replacing unstable, basic models with community-optimized VSM libraries, you can reliably test complex networks, filter logic, and error-handling routines right on your PC. A great MCP2515 library should be reliable, well-supported,

Type MCP2515 into the keywords box. You will see your newly added, feature-rich component appear under the results. Verifying Simulation Accuracy with a Virtual CAN Analyzer

[ Arduino Uno ] --(SPI Pins: 11, 12, 13, 10)--> [ Better MCP2515 Model ] | (TXCAN / RXCAN) | [ MCP2551 Transceiver ] | (CAN_H / CAN_L) | [ Proteus CAN Analyzer ]

high level of integration and accuracy compared to standard generic models Review: MCP2515 Simulation Library for Proteus Load your firmware (e

A truly better library doesn’t just exist—it’s the one that respects timing, interrupts, and real-world edge cases. And sometimes, it’s hidden in a GitHub repo with a stubborn README.

The most reliable way to simulate CAN Bus projects in Proteus is actually to use the MCP2515 directly. Instead, use the COMPIM model combined with a virtual CAN terminal.